Professor Emeritus Jerry Knutson named recipient of 2024 U of M President's Award for Outstanding Service

University of Minnesota Crookston Professor Emeritus Jerome "Jerry" Knutson was named a recipient of the 2024 President's Award for Outstanding Service and was recognized by University of Minnesota Interim President Jeffrey Ettinger at the May Board of Regents meeting. Knutson was nominated by U of M Crookston alumna Dr. Kari Torkelson with letters of support from U of M Crookston Professor Emeriti Dan Svedarsky, Ph.D. and Marsha Odom, and U of M Crookston Director of Advancement and Alumni Relations Kevin Thompson, Ph.D.

A reception honoring 2024 award recipients, including Knutson, will be held in June at the Weisman Art Museum in Minneapolis.

Ettinger said in his award letter to Knutson that his excellence was "a model for your colleagues and co-workers to emulate" and told him he had done "more than your share to make the University of Minnesota one of the preeminent institutions in the nation."

"I am humbled and honored to receive the President's Award for Service for doing what I enjoy - supporting students," shared Knutson. "I always believed it was my opportunity and responsibility to attend student events like commencements, homecomings, convocations, athletics events, music concerts, theater productions, even area alumni beer bashes."

"It was also my opportunity and responsibility to help students reach their potential, learn a little biology, appreciate nature and environment, respect and support university, state, and nation, and actively participate in their communities," he added. "If service means helping and supporting students and the campus, then I hope I have served UMC during my 35 years in faculty and 20 years of retirement."
